UK chip designer ARM Holdings has come under the market spotlight as rumours do the rounds that it could be an acquisition target for Apple, reports The Guardian. The Cambridge-based firm, whose microchips can be found in most of the world’s mobile phones, including Apple’s iPhone, would likely cost more than £3 billion according to reports.
